Hail typically forms in thunderstorms with strong updrafts, where temperatures can be much colder than surface temperatures. While surface temperatures can be around 60 degrees Fahrenheit, the upper parts of the storm, where hail forms, can be at freezing temperatures or lower. Therefore, it is possible for hail to develop when the surface temperature is 60 degrees, but the conditions must be right in the storm's structure.

A set of angles can form a triangle if the sum of the three angles is exactly 180 degrees. Additionally, each angle must be greater than 0 degrees. This means that any combination of three positive angles that adds up to 180 degrees qualifies as the angles of a triangle. For example, angles of 60°, 60°, and 60° or 30°, 60°, and 90° both form valid triangles.
